Satoru Nakajima Bio

Satoru Nakajima is a prominent figure in the world of motorsports, particularly known for his achievements as a Formula One racing driver. Born on February 23, 1953, in Omaezaki, Japan, Nakajima is widely recognized as the first full-time Japanese driver in Formula One and has greatly contributed to the sport's popularity within his home country. His impactful career spanned over a decade from 1987 to 1997, during which he raced for the Lotus and Tyrrell teams.

Before making his mark on the international racing scene, Nakajima honed his skills in Japanese motorsports. He began his journey in racing as a go-kart driver, quickly gaining recognition for his exceptional talent. Subsequently, he transitioned to Japanese Formula Two, where he clinched two championship titles in 1981 and 1982, solidifying his position as one of Japan's most promising drivers.

In 1987, Nakajima embarked on his Formula One career, joining Team Lotus as their primary driver. Competing against the world's best drivers, he faced numerous challenges but managed to deliver impressive performances. One of his most notable achievements was securing his maiden podium finish at the 1989 Australian Grand Prix, earning him a well-deserved third place on the podium. This accomplishment made Nakajima the first Japanese driver ever to reach such heights in Formula One, playing a pivotal role in inspiring a new generation of Japanese racers.

Throughout his Formula One career, Nakajima showcased remarkable perseverance, resilience, and determination. Despite facing technical difficulties, fierce competition, and unfortunate incidents, he demonstrated unwavering commitment to his craft. Known for his cool demeanor and disciplined approach, Nakajima left an indelible mark on the history of Formula One, specifically in shaping its landscape for Japanese drivers.

While Nakajima eventually retired from Formula One in 1997, his impact on the sport remains significant. His achievements paved the way for future Japanese drivers in Formula One, fostering a growing interest in motorsports within Japan. Today, Satoru Nakajima stands not only as an accomplished Japanese racing driver but also as a revered figure whose legacy continues to inspire aspiring racers around the world.
